AI Transparency Report

The Price Foundation Charitable Trust demonstrates consistent financial activity, with revenues generally exceeding expenses in recent years, contributing to a stable asset base. For example, in 2023, revenue was $106,512 against expenses of $100,163, showing a surplus. The organization maintains a very low liability profile, consistently reporting $1 or $0 in liabilities across all available filings, which is a strong indicator of financial stability and responsible management. However, the provided data lacks a detailed breakdown of expenses into program, administrative, and fundraising categories, making it challenging to fully assess spending efficiency. Without this information, it's difficult to determine what percentage of funds directly support charitable programs versus overhead. The absence of officer compensation across all filings suggests either a volunteer-led structure or that compensation is handled through other means not reported in this section, which could be a positive for efficiency if truly volunteer-driven. Transparency is moderate given the available data. While the top-level financial figures are provided, the lack of granular expense details limits a comprehensive understanding of how funds are allocated. The consistent filing of IRS Form 990s over a decade indicates adherence to reporting requirements, which is a positive aspect of transparency.

Filing History

IRS 990 filing history for Price Foundation Charitable Trust showing financial trends over 10 years of public records:

Over 10 years of IRS 990 filings (2011–2023), Price Foundation Charitable Trust's revenue has grown by 381.8%, moving from $22K to $107K. Total assets decreased by 37.7% over the same period, from $416K to $259K. Total functional expenses rose by 50.5%, from $67K to $100K. In its most recent filing year (2023), Price Foundation Charitable Trust reported a surplus of $6K, with revenue exceeding expenses. The organization holds $1 in liabilities against $259K in assets (debt-to-asset ratio: 0.0%), resulting in net assets of $259K.
